Alberta jobless rate bucks national trend
_QR77 Newsroom
3/12/2010

Alberta was the only province with a notable employment loss in February pushing the unemployment rate up 0.3 percentage points to 6.9 per cent, compared to 6.6 per cent in January.
15,000 jobs were lost in February in Alberta.
February marks the second month of employment declines in the province, bringing employment 0.9% (-19,000) lower than it was a year ago.
